Renault Nissan Alliance to invest Rs 5,300 crore in India, plans six new models including 2 EVs

Alliance partners rejig their JV stake to 51:49 with Nissan holding the majority. The additional R&D activities will create up to 2,000 new jobs and the alliance expects the Chennai factory to become a carbon-neutral vehicle manufacturing plant

13 Feb 2023 | 13061 Views | By Ketan Thakkar

In a bid to make a comeback in the mainstream Indian market, the Renault Nissan Alliance has committed a fresh investment of Rs 5,300 crore in the Indian market which will see it introduce six models including two electric vehicles in the country.
